Description

n-Chlorotaurine is a chemically synthesized derivative of the amino acid taurine, featuring a chlorine substitution that imparts potent oxidative and chlorinating properties. This compound is valued for its role as a selective and effective oxidizing agent in organic synthesis and as a biochemical tool for studying oxidative stress pathways. It is primarily utilized by research institutions and pharmaceutical companies engaged in the development of novel bioactive molecules and analytical methodologies.

Application

  • Organic Synthesis Intermediate: Serves as a key reagent for the selective chlorination and oxidation of sensitive substrates in complex molecule construction.
  • Biochemical Research: Used as a tool compound to study oxidative stress, neutrophil-mediated antimicrobial activity, and halogenation mechanisms in biological systems.
  • Pharmaceutical Research: Investigated for its potential as a precursor or active moiety in the development of new therapeutic agents with antimicrobial or anti-inflammatory properties.
  • Analytical Chemistry: Employed as a standard or reagent in chromatographic and spectroscopic methods for analyzing taurine derivatives and related compounds.

Basic Information

Product Name n-Chlorotaurine
CAS No. 51036-13-6
Molecular Formula C₂H₆ClNO₃S
Molecular Weight 159.59 g/mol
Synonyms 2-Chloroaminoethanesulfonic Acid; N-Chlorotaurine; Taurine Chloramine; Chlorotaurine; Monochlorotaurine; TauCl; 2-Aminoethanesulfonic Acid N-Chloro Derivative

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at 2-8°C under an inert atmosphere to minimize oxidation and degradation. Keep away from strong oxidizing agents and reducing agents.
